What is the proper way to charge these cells. I have a number of AA's that are all weak. I have tried charging them at a constant rate of about .050A overnight and they seem to come up and they will work but don't last very long. Can these be charged manually as you would Nicads or is there a special trick to this? Thanks, Lenny Stein, Barlen Electronics.

Hi Lenny...
Respectfully suggest that that's because you aren't charging them, you're just teasing them a little :)
Unless 50 mills is a mis-type, that is.
If you really have to charge them manually, then read the capacity (current "normal" is 2500 mah) and charge them 10 percent (250 mils in this case) for 14 hours.
Or better, buy yourself a nimh charger. If the budget is a concern, then Walmart has an Eveready "dumb" charger that comes with two AA's, all for only a little under 10 dollars (cdn).
If the budget isn't of concern, then there are "smart" chargers available that will on an individual cell basis pre-determine the state of charge, charge them to 100% quickly, and then leave them on trickle (about your 50 mil rate) until you remove them.

When a set of four is brand new they usually all charge in the same time, but as they age it seems that one or two cells in the set will become different from the others and will take much longer to charge. When that happens I don't see how two different cells can be charged properly if they're on the same circuit. That's why I like the Maha C401FS chargers that have individual circuits for each cell. I also have a couple of the older Maha C204Fs which reviewers all raved about, but because they charge cells in pairs I now use them only occasionally for the conditioning feature.

Theoretically speaking, slow charging will give more recharge cycles before the cell is worn out. However, with a decent delta-v charger doing fast charging, it's less of an issue these days. In the past, fast charging cells using the timer method was brutal and could often result in overheating and overcharging.
